Hi guys, yesterday I went out on the water with boat with a Yamaha 50hp short shaft motor.All was going well for about 10min on the water, engine ran well at max revs and boat got on plane.Then it slowly started losing power like something that doesn't get fuel.I stoped to check fuel tank level, it was fine, I removed the engine cover to check if fuel gets to the carburators and it did.I pumped the bulb just to make sure and it was hard.While engine was running I removed the sparkplug caps one by one every time hearing a difference making me believe that all of the sparkplugs fired.After that I put it in neutral and reved it, revs went up as normal, engaged it in fwd but still it only ran at half the revs it used to.Please help!!!!!

Re: Yamaha 50hp no revs under load

Sounds like a fuel problem. Dirt in filter, weak fuel pump, stuck carb float, etc. Reving in neutral doesn't mean much, cause it don't take much gas to do that.

Re: Yamaha 50hp no revs under load

may have overheated or low on oil and safe mode was triggered.
Hard to tell what motor you are dealing with since you did not post the model #

Test the alarm system to make sure it works properly, giving an audible alarm and lights if you have that
You can check timing when running good and bad to see if the safe mode has retarded the timing
